About Corix 

Corix designs, builds, finances, owns and operates low-carbon energy solutions for communities across North America. We’re creating a sustainable future for the next generation and beyond.  

Headquartered in Vancouver, BC, Corix is a privately held corporation owned by British Columbia Investment Management Corporation (BCI), a large, stable and globally respected investment firm.

Core Responsibilities 

 

Payroll & Benefits  

  • Run end‑to‑end bi‑weekly and semi‑monthly payroll for US and Canadian employees 

  • Manage complex payroll items including bonuses, incentives, overtime, and deductions 

  • Administer benefits enrollments, changes, and terminations across payroll systems and external carriers 

  • Support RRSP and 401(k) administration, deductions, and reconciliations 

  • Prepare payroll reports; lead month-end and year-end processes, including T4 and W-2 issuance 

  • Respond to payroll and benefits inquiries and ensure ongoing legislative compliance 

 

People Operations & HR Administration 

  • Maintain accurate and compliant employee records across HR and payroll systems 

  • Administer leaves of absence, coordinating with benefits carriers and third‑party administrators 

  • Support the full employee lifecycle — onboarding, role changes, offboarding — from a systems and documentation perspective 

  • Administer and track compliance training and policy acknowledgements 

 

Systems Thinking & Process Reinvention 

  • Conduct a structured audit of the current payroll function: map every process, identify what’s manual, and build a roadmap for what automation and AI can absorb 

  • Design and implement improvements that meaningfully reduce manual effort, improve accuracy, and create scalable infrastructure 

  • Stay close to what’s emerging in payroll technology, AI-enabled HR tools, and workflow automation — and bring recommendations forward 

  • Over time, expand this systems lens to other people operations processes and, with organizational support, to other functions

What you need to know about the Vancouver Tech Scene

Raincouver, Vancity, The Big Smoke — Vancouver is known by many names, and in recent years, it has gained a reputation as a growing hub for both tech and sustainability. Renowned for its natural beauty, the city has become a magnet for professionals eager to create environmental solutions, and with an emphasis on clean technology, renewable energy and environmental innovation, it's attracted companies across various industries, all working toward a shared goal: advancing clean technology.
